Job Description WHO WE NEED We LOVE to train! We are looking for an individual who... • Genuinely enjoys working with animals and is able to deal with them even when they are stressed, ill or in pain., • Can stay calm and efficient during a medical crisis., • Is well-spoken and approaches his/her job duties in a mature nature., • Is experienced in the teamwork approach and works well with all levels of hospital team members., • Has excellent client communication skills., • Physical Effort: Work requires lifting and carrying animals (will be assisted by other staff members in lifting animals over 40 lbs). Walks or stands for extended periods or time; frequently works in a bent position., • Working conditions: May be exposed to unpleasant odors, noises and animal feces. May be exposed to bites, scratches and contagious diseases., • Can provide compassionate care to patients and clients., • Can conduct oneself in a confident and professional manner even when stressed and/or focused on individual tasks., • Can prepare and maintain the exam rooms and treatment areas., • Can perform physical assessments; record observations in computer., • Can effectively restrain pets even when large or difficult., • Understands all common vaccinations and vaccination protocols and can explain to clients., • Understands the importance of a clean and orderly facility, does not hesitate to clean or organize as part of a normal job duty., • Maintains positive, cooperative relationships with other employees., • Gives SQ, IM and IV injections., • Can handle client’s medical questions with confidence and direct to veterinarians when appropriate., • Can prepare estimates for procedures and discuss financial commitments with clients supporting hospital financial policies., • Can explain necessary follow-up and home care instructions., • Understands usage, dosage, and common side-effects for commonly used prescription drugs and can readily explain them to the clients., • Can maintain an appropriate inventory of all medical supplies as determined by the inventory control system., • Can assist the veterinarian in medical, surgical and dental procedures; prepares patients for surgery; administers anesthesia; monitors patients during surgery and recovery; administers fluids., • Can properly care for all surgical materials; keep the operating room properly stocked and prepared for surgery., • Can perform clinical laboratory procedures such as fecal flotation exams, heartworm checks, skin scrapings, urinalysis, and fungal cultures; draws blood for laboratory analysis; maintains file of lab test results and ensures that test results are recorded in patient records., • Can effectively position for and take radiographs., • Can place IV catheters and properly care for them.
